For centuries, traditional Bhutanese boots, known as tshoglam, were a symbol of cultural and national identity. By the late 1990s, this age-old craft was gradually vanishing. One man saw an opportunity in preserving this heritage.

Meet Jangchubla, 48, one of the few master bootmakers in the country.

Over the past 23 years, he has dedicated his life to revitalising and modernising the tshoglam. Today, he runs Traditional Boot House in ...
